Job Description

The Applications Development Intermediate Programmer Analyst is an intermediate level position responsible for participation in the establishment and implementation of new or revised application systems and programs in coordination with the Technology team. The overall objective of this role is to contribute to applications systems analysis and programming activities.

Job Responsibility

  • Design, develop, and implement automation workflows using Xceptor and Automation Anywhere
  • Build and maintain test automation frameworks using Selenium and Python
  • Automate repetitive tasks and processes to improve operational efficiency
  • Collaborate with business and technical teams to identify automation opportunities
  • Analyze existing processes and recommend improvements to enhance performance and scalability
  • Integrate automation solutions with existing systems and tools
  • Deploy and monitor automation workflows in production environments
  • Create and maintain detailed documentation for automation workflows, scripts, and processes
  • Provide regular updates and reports on automation progress and outcomes
  • Work closely with cross-functional teams, including developers, QA, and business analysts, to ensure alignment with project goals
  • Provide support and training to team members on automation tools and best practices

Requirements

  • 3-8 years of hands-on experience in automation development
  • Proficiency in Xceptor and Automation Anywhere for process automation
  • Strong knowledge of Selenium for test automation
  • Expertise in Python for scripting and automation
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ills to identify and resolve automation challenges
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ills to collaborate with stakeholders and document processes effectively
  • Familiarity with version control systems, CI/CD pipelines, and other automation tools is a plus

Nice to have

  • Experience in integrating automation solutions with APIs and databases
  • Knowledge of RPA best practices and governance
  • Familiarity with Agile methodologies and tools like JIRA or Confluence
  • Certification in Xceptor, Automation Anywhere, Python or Selenium is a plus
